A ¼-hp, 230-V, 60-Hz, four-pole, single-phase inductionmotor has the following parameters and losses: R1 = 10 , Xl1 = Xl2 = 12.5 ,R2 = 11.5 , and Xm = 250 . The core loss at 230 V is 35 Wand the friction and windage loss is 10W. For a slip of 0.05, determine the stator current, power factor, developed power, shaft output power, speed, torque, and efficiency when the motor is running as a single-phase motor at rated voltage and frequency with its starting winding open.
